Huskers Fall at No. 21 Ohio State

The Nebraska men's basketball team, playing its second road game in four days, could not overcome a strong shooting performance from No. 21 Ohio State Tuesday night, as the Huskers fell to the Buckeyes 80-68 at Value City Arena.

Ohio State (12-5, 2-4 Big Ten) shot 54.5 percent on the night, the highest percentage by a Husker opponent this season. The Buckeyes were 30-of-55 from the field, including 10-of-22 from the 3-point line. CJ Walker, who scored 14 second-half points, paced six Buckeyes in double figures with a game-high 18 points. Kaleb Wesson added a double-double for Ohio State with 13 points and 14 rebounds.
